Graham WARING Obituary

WARING, Graham Stanley:
On March 12, 2018, aged 81 years, peacefully at home. Precious husband of Anne. Loving father and father-in-law of Rosalie & Garrett, Marty & Viv, Steve & Ali. Loved grandfather of Ken & Tanya, Sam & Lorraine, Mike, Olivia & Matt, Frances, Chantelle & Kim, Luke & Sheryl, Acacia & Joe, Zeke, Matt & Denise, Tabi & Roy, Stevie & Ants, Nela. Treasured Great-Grandfather of Mackie, Sophie, Caleb, Finley, Harley, Honor, Lexi, Milo, Mason, Nova & Frankie May. A Celebration of life will be held at the Upper Hutt Salvation Army, 695 Fergusson Drive, Upper Hutt, on Thursday, March 15, 2018, at 1.30pm.
"Promoted to Glory"

Published by Dominion Post on Mar. 14, 2018.
